Basement Jaxx have teamed up with Yoko Ono for their new album.
The band are currently penning tracks for the follow up to 2006’s ’Crazy Itch Radio’.
Member Felix Buxton said of the new collaboration: “We ended up doing a couple of things, once I started listening to her stuff. I think she was miles ahead.
"She should be on the new album. I mean, we haven’t finished any tracks at the moment, but we are working on her things.”
The duo also revealed that they are keen to get Grace Jones on the new album, but so far have found her elusive.
Buxton said: “We have been trying to work with her for years, but she keeps disappearing, her manager said she was up for it before.”
He also mentioned that he wanted the album to be a double “One album will be soundscapes, the other one will be pure tracks,” he said.
They hope to release the album in spring of 2008, reports BBC 6 Music.
